EDITORS COMMENTS
This stunning hand-colored lithograph depicts the Indian ringneck parakeet, Psittacula krameri manillensis, in all its vibrant pink and green glory. The parakeet, a member of the parrot family (Psittaciformes, specifically the Psittacidae subfamily), is perched gracefully on a branch, showcasing its distinctive collar of pink feathers encircling its neck. The intricate details of the parakeet's anatomy are beautifully rendered, from the curved beak and expressive eyes to the delicate quills of its feathers. Edward Lear, the renowned English artist and author, created this illustration as part of his comprehensive work, "Illustrations of the Family of Psittacidae or Parrots," published in 1832. The nineteenth century was a period of great fascination with the natural world, and such detailed and accurate depictions of exotic animals, particularly birds, were highly sought after. Lear's mastery of the lithographic process is evident in the rich colors and fine lines of this print. The use of hand coloring further enhances the artwork, bringing the Indian ringneck parakeet to life in a way that a black-and-white reproduction could not. The parakeet's pink plumage is particularly striking, adding a pop of color against the green background of the foliage. The Indian ringneck parakeet, also known as the lutino or rose-ringed parakeet, is native to South Asia and is now widely introduced in other parts of the world due to its popularity as a pet. This illustration serves as a reminder of the natural beauty that inspired collectors and artists alike during the nineteenth century, and continues to captivate us today.
